Does anybody know if the clear bumper lights form the 88-89 accord will work on the 86-87?.

Dibbs
10-30-2003, 10:10 AM
nope...they sure won't

tuner4life
10-30-2003, 10:39 AM
Y?

HostileJava
10-30-2003, 11:00 AM
they are to big, they won't fit.

Dibbs
10-30-2003, 11:01 AM
You could always do a bumper swap and get clears that way.
